Message type: E = Error
Message class: DG - DG: Messages for Dangerous Goods Management
Message number: 681
Message text: ********** Results of Enterprise-Specific Mixed Loading Checks **********

- ********** Results of Enterprise-Specific Mixed Loading Checks ********** ?The SAP error message DG681 typically relates to issues with mixed loading checks in the context of enterprise-specific data handling. This error can occur when there are inconsistencies or conflicts in the data being processed, particularly when dealing with mixed loading scenarios where different types of data or materials are being handled together.
Cause:
- Mixed Loading Rules: The error may arise due to violations of mixed loading rules defined in the system. This can happen if the system detects that certain materials or products cannot be loaded together based on predefined criteria.
- Incompatible Material Types: The materials being loaded may have incompatible characteristics, such as different handling requirements, hazardous material classifications, or temperature control needs.
- Configuration Issues: There may be configuration settings in the SAP system that are not aligned with the business processes or requirements, leading to conflicts during the loading process.
- Data Integrity Issues: Inconsistencies in master data or transactional data can also trigger this error, especially if the data does not meet the criteria for mixed loading.
Solution:
- Review Mixed Loading Rules: Check the mixed loading rules configured in the system. Ensure that the materials being loaded together comply with these rules. You may need to adjust the rules or the materials involved.
- Material Compatibility Check: Verify the compatibility of the materials being loaded. If certain materials cannot be mixed, consider separating them into different loads.
- Configuration Review: Review the configuration settings related to mixed loading in the SAP system. Ensure that they align with the business requirements and processes.
- Data Validation: Conduct a thorough validation of the master data and transactional data involved in the loading process. Correct any inconsistencies or errors found.
-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for specific guidance on handling mixed loading checks and resolving related errors.
